Provisional Licence
1st Provisional Licence
Licence application must be accompanied by:- Theory Test Certificate
- Eyesight Report

- The first provisional licence is valid for two years
- The licence holder, with the exception of those who hold provisional licences in Category M, A1, A or W must be accompanied by a qualified driver at all times while driving.
- You may apply for categories EB, C1, C, D1, D, if you have a full B Licence
- You may apply for Categories EC1, EC, ED1, ED, if you have a full licence in the relevant drawing vehicle.
Second Provisional Licence
Licence application must be accompanied by:- Application form (D201), fully completed
- Two recent identical Passport Type Photographs (signed on back)
- Current or most recent provisional licence. If lost, form D8a to be completed
form D8a (PDF - 57 Kb)
- The second provisional licence is valid for two years
- You may drive, unaccompanied by a qualified driver, if you hold a second provisional licence in category B
Third or subsequent Provisional Licence
Licence application must be accompanied by:- Application form D201, fully completed
- Two recent identical passport type photographs (signed on back)
- Current or most recent provisional licence. If lost, form D8a to be completed.
form D8a (PDF - 57 Kb)
- The licence holder, with the exception of those who hold provisional licences in Category M, A1, A or W must be accompanied by a qualified driver at all times while driving
Important Note:
The following forms:- D.401, Application for Issue Or Renewal Of Driving Licence,
- D.800, Application for Duplicate Driving Licence,
- D.201, Application for Provisional Driving Licence,
cannot be downloaded from the website at this time due to a specific signature requirement which has to be affixed to your licence.They are available at our offices, City Library and Garda stations.
